Sheridan Elder Research Centres (SERC)
Located on the Oakville, Ontario campus of the Sheridan Institute of Technology and Advanced Learning, the
Sheridan Elder Research Centre benefits from Sheridan’s institutional strengths, the diversity of its programs and a research setting that offers a friendly and accessible environment whereby older adults from the community not only participate in research but also shape its direction. Our affiliated researchers and volunteers are dedicated to developing, testing and implementing innovative, realistic solutions that improve the day-to-day lives of older adults and their families.
Centre for Advanced Manufacturing and Design Technologies (CAMDT)
Canadian manufacturing continues to evolve to compete globally, with knowledge and technology as the keys to our success. The eight-million dollar
Centre for Advanced Manufacturing and Design Technologies (CAMDT) venture is a partnership with over 20 regional manufacturers, the
Province of Ontario and the
City of Brampton… and together we are changing the face of manufacturing in Canada.

Shared Hierarchical Academic Research Computing Network (SHARCNET)
SHARCNET is a consortium of Canadian academic institutions who share a network of high performance computers. With this infrastructure we enable world-class academic research.
SHARCNET aims to accelerate computational academic research, attract the best students and faculty to our partner institutions by providing cutting edge expertise and hardware and link academic researchers with corporate partners in a search for new business opportunities
Sheridan Visual Design Institute (VDI)
The
Sheridan Visualization Design Institute is dedicated to innovation in the field of interactive digital media, and specializes in developing visualization technologies for education, training, and entertainment. Situated within Sheridan's renowned high-tech animation teaching environment, SCAET, the institute’s team of researchers and technologists has an eleven-year history of conducting diverse research programs in collaboration with industry and academic partners. VDI creates visionary products and experiences in collaboration with industry and academic partners.
